The Court has reviewed the Plaintiff's Request for Judicial Notice in Support of Plaintiff's Opposition to the Defendants' Motion to Dismiss, including the legal authorities cited therein. The Court rules as follows: Judicial notice may be taken of the existence of documents filed in any federal or state court because their existence is not susceptible to reasonable dispute. See Robert E. Jones et al., RUTTER GROUP PRACTICE GUIDE: FEDERAL CIVIL TRIALS AND EVIDENCE, ยง 8:875 (2007). This includes both records filed previously in the current litigation and recorded in other proceedings. See, e.g., United States ex. rel. Robinson Rancheria Citizens Council v. Borneo, Inc., 971 F.2d 244, 248 (9th Cir. 1992) ("[W]e may take notice of proceedings in other courts, both within and without the federal judicial system, if those proceedings have a direct relation to matters at issue."). Federal courts may take judicial notice of guidelines, manuals, and rules of federal and state governmental agencies. See Lockyer v. County of Santa Cruz, 2006 WL 3086706, at *3 n.3 (N.D. Cal. Oct. 30, 2006) (granting judicial notice of US DOJ checklist for polling places, available on US DOJ website); Kothmann Enters., Inc. v. Trinity Industries, Inc., 455 F. Supp. 2d 608, 929 (S.D. Tex. 2006) (taking judicial notice of USPTO Manual on Patent Examining Procedure); Driebel v. City of Milwaukee, 298 F.3d 622, 631 n.2 (7th Cir. 2002) (taking judicial notice of a police department manual containing rules and regulations promulgated by the chief of police); Gleave v. Graham, 954 F. Supp. 599, 605 (W.D.N.Y. 1997) (taking judicial notice of Bureau of Prisons' office internal agency guidelines). The documents identified by Plaintiff meet these criteria. Having found good cause as being shown, IT IS ORDERED as follows: Plaintiff's Request for Judicial Notice is GRANTED. IT IS SO ORDERED.
